Output 366dc08b30f79658ff7120ccdc47766d25c75dcfd3b7eb9326b9fa4e98d25cd5:0

value
58376850
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0022d66ceb095ce3956de76a31387279360a7591 OP_EQUAL
address
31hjf6uQ3AF4ygPxGL2SgWA5Szk8kj9EiJ
transaction
366dc08b30f79658ff7120ccdc47766d25c75dcfd3b7eb9326b9fa4e98d25cd5
spent
true